The average HVAC replacement cost in 2026 runs $7,000–$12,500 for a standard central air conditioning and heating system in a typical American home β€” up 15–20% from 2023 pricing, driven by a combination of new refrigerant regulations, the A2L transition, persistent skilled labor shortages, and the tariff environment affecting imported HVAC components. For homeowners whose system is 12–15 years old and starting to require annual service calls, the replacement math in 2026 is increasingly clear: repair costs compound faster than they used to, and the efficiency gains from a new system have grown more financially meaningful as utility rates rise.

Understanding real HVAC replacement cost in 2026 requires knowing which system type your home uses, the specific regulatory changes affecting equipment selection this year, and the labor market conditions in your region. A split system in Atlanta and a split system in Boston involve the same equipment category but very different installed costs β€” and a heat pump system that was niche in 2022 is now increasingly the default recommendation in moderate climates due to both efficiency gains and federal incentive eligibility.

2. The A2L Refrigerant Transition β€” Why 2026 HVAC Costs Are Higher

The most significant driver of elevated HVAC replacement cost in 2026 is the transition from R-410A to A2L refrigerants (primarily R-32 and R-454B) mandated by New York State’s HFC phase-down rules and the federal AIM Act, effective January 1, 2025. R-410A equipment is no longer manufactured β€” all new residential HVAC equipment uses A2L refrigerants, which are mildly flammable and require specific installation protocols.

The practical cost implications of the A2L transition:

  • Technician certification: A2L installation requires updated EPA 608 certification. Some regions face technician shortages as the transition works through the installer workforce β€” adding scheduling delays and premium pricing.
  • Equipment cost increase: A2L-compatible equipment carries a 10–20% premium over equivalent R-410A equipment from 2023. Industry consensus is that this premium will moderate as supply chains normalize through 2026–2027.
  • NYC-specific addition: New York City code requires A2L refrigerant lines to run through fire-rated, sealed shafts with venting and leak-detection sensors β€” adding $1,500–$4,000 to NYC-area HVAC installations specifically.

⚠️ R-410A system owners: If your R-410A system needs a refrigerant recharge in 2026, the cost has risen significantly as R-410A supplies tighten post-phaseout. A recharge that cost $150–$300 in 2023 may run $400–$800 in 2026 depending on your region. This changes the repair-versus-replace calculation materially for older systems.


3. Federal Tax Credits β€” The IRA Incentives That Offset HVAC Replacement Cost

The Inflation Reduction Act’s Β§25C Energy Efficient Home Improvement Credit provides meaningful offsets to HVAC replacement cost in 2026 for qualifying equipment. The credit covers 30% of qualifying HVAC equipment and installation costs, up to annual limits:

  • Heat pumps (air source): Up to $2,000 per year
  • Heat pump water heaters: Up to $2,000 per year (combined with HVAC heat pumps)
  • Central AC and gas furnaces: Up to $600 per year each
  • Electrical panel upgrades: Up to $600 per year if required for HVAC installation

For a homeowner replacing a full system with a qualifying heat pump at $10,000 installed cost: 30% credit = $3,000 potential credit, capped at $2,000 for heat pumps. Net cost after credit: $8,000. On top of federal credits, many state and utility programs offer additional rebates β€” the Database of State Incentives for Renewables & Efficiency (DSIRE) lists all available programs by zip code.

IRA credit status 2026: The Β§25C credits remain available for 2026 under current law. The One Big Beautiful Bill Act (signed July 4, 2025) made changes to some energy credits β€” consult a tax professional for current eligibility confirmation before making replacement decisions based on credit availability.

4. HVAC Replacement Cost 2026 β€” Regional Variation

RegionFull System Replacementvs National AvgKey Driver
New York City metro$11,000–$18,000+45–65%Union labor, A2L shaft requirements, permits
California (coastal)$9,500–$16,000+30–50%Labor rates, Title 24, permit requirements
Pacific Northwest$8,500–$14,000+20–40%Heat pump adoption high β€” more experienced crews
Midwest (Chicago, OH)$7,500–$12,000+5–20%Moderate labor premium, dual-fuel systems common
Texas / Southwest$6,000–$10,000-10–+5%Competitive market, AC-dominant systems
Southeast (GA, TN, FL)$5,500–$9,500-15–0%Most competitive HVAC labor market in the US

5. Repair vs Replace β€” The 2026 Decision Framework

The classic repair-versus-replace decision on HVAC equipment has shifted in 2026. The R-410A refrigerant cost increase changes the math significantly for older systems that need recharging. A system that is 12+ years old, requires an $800 R-410A recharge, and is running at 10–12 SEER (old efficiency standard) has a straightforward replacement case in most markets: the recharge buys 1–3 years of unreliable operation on aging equipment, while replacement delivers 15–20 years of reliability at 40–60% lower operating cost.

  • Replace if: System is 12+ years old, requires R-410A recharge, repair cost exceeds 50% of replacement cost, or efficiency is below 14 SEER
  • Repair if: System is under 8 years old, repair is under $1,500, and the failure is a specific component (capacitor, contactor, motor) rather than compressor or refrigerant leak
  • The compressor rule: A failed compressor on a system over 8 years old almost always justifies replacement β€” compressor replacement costs $1,200–$2,500 and the remaining system components are at similar age-related failure risk

6. My Take

In my view, HVAC replacement cost in 2026 is the home improvement expenditure with the clearest financial case in the current market environment. Utility rates are higher than 2020, the federal tax credit for heat pumps is real and substantial, and the A2L transition has made repairs on older R-410A systems meaningfully more expensive β€” which closes the gap between repair and replacement faster than any prior technology transition in HVAC history.

For homeowners in moderate climates β€” Pacific Northwest, Mid-Atlantic, Southeast β€” a heat pump system is now the financially dominant choice over a gas furnace and AC split system when doing a full replacement. The operating cost savings combined with the $2,000 federal credit typically produce a better financial outcome over a 10-year hold period even when the upfront equipment cost is higher. The exception is severe cold climates (Minneapolis, northern New England) where a hybrid dual-fuel system β€” heat pump for most of the heating season, gas backup for extreme cold β€” delivers the best combination of efficiency and reliability.

Bottom line: HVAC replacement cost in 2026 runs $7,000–$12,500 for a standard central system, up 15–20% from 2023. Check Β§25C federal tax credit eligibility before choosing equipment β€” up to $2,000 back for qualifying heat pumps. Get three quotes minimum, verify A2L certification for all bidding contractors, and avoid R-410A recharges on systems over 10 years old β€” the math no longer supports it.
